The next step involves removing the existing drain hose. Follow these instructions carefully to avoid damaging other components.
Locate the drain hose at the back of the washing machine.
Loosen the clamp securing the hose using an adjustable wrench.
Gently pull the hose off the drain port and dispose of it properly.

Installing the new drain hose is straightforward. Ensure you follow these steps to secure a proper fit.
Align the new drain hose with the drain port.
Slide the hose onto the port until it fits snugly.
Secure the clamp around the hose using the adjustable wrench to prevent leaks.

After installation, it is crucial to test the new drain hose to ensure it functions correctly. Follow these steps to verify proper operation.
Plug the washing machine back into the power source.
Turn on the water supply and check for leaks around the connection.
Run a short cycle to ensure water drains properly.

Even after replacing the drain hose, you may encounter issues. Here are some common problems and solutions.
Hose kinks: Ensure the hose is not twisted or bent.
Improper drainage: Check for clogs in the hose or drain.
Leaking connections: Tighten the clamp if water seeps from the connection.
